Hola buenas, estoy desarrollando una aplicación en la que obtengo mediante SQL los alumnos de una clase y en la tabla muesro sus datos, incluyendo si han asistido o no ha clase. Necesito que el profesor manualmente pueda añadir quitar una falta pero no se como enviar dichos datos para hacerlo:
mi consulta es la siguiente: (Utilizo PDO)
Código PHP:
$consulta = "SELECT nombre, apellido1, apellido2, matricula FROM $dbDb.alumnos WHERE xunidad='$xunidad' ORDER BY apellido1 ASC";
$result = $db->query($consulta);
foreach ($result3 as $valor3) {
$id=$valor3[id];
$nombre=$valor3[nombre];
$apellido1=$valor3[apellido1];
$apellido2=$valor3[apellido2];
//creo la consulta para ver quien ha asistido y quien no
$consulta2 = "SELECT COUNT(*) FROM $dbDb.asistencia WHERE matricula='$matricula' AND fechaasistencia='$fecha'";
$result2 = $db->prepare($consulta2);
$result2->execute();
if($result2->fetchColumn()>=1){
$checkbox ='<input type='checkbox' name='asistencia' value='$id' checked>";
}
else{
$checkbox ='<input type='checkbox' name='asistencia' value='$id'>";
}
}
El código está copiado y pegado asiqe es posible que me falte algo de info (como el submit). pero la pregunta es cómo puedo recoger que alumno ha faltado (es decir, tiene el checkbox sin marcar) y cual lo tiene marcado?
Muchas gracias y si me dejo algo importante atrás decidmelo que o coriijo